Home
last modified time | relevance | path

Searched refs:FrameId (Results 1 – 3 of 3) sorted by relevance

/device/generic/goldfish/network/wifi_forwarder/
Dframe_id.h23 struct FrameId { struct
24 FrameId() {} in FrameId() argument
25 FrameId(uint64_t cookie, const MacAddress& transmitter) in FrameId() function
28 FrameId(const FrameId&) = default;
29 FrameId(FrameId&&) = default;
31 FrameId& operator=(const FrameId&) = default; argument
32 FrameId& operator=(FrameId&&) = default; argument
39 template<> struct hash<FrameId> { argument
40 size_t operator()(const FrameId& id) const {
49 inline bool operator==(const FrameId& left, const FrameId& right) {
[all …]
Dlocal_connection.h79 Cache<FrameId, std::unique_ptr<Frame>> mPendingFrames;
81 Cache<uint32_t, FrameId> mSequenceNumberCookies;
90 std::priority_queue<std::pair<Timestamp, FrameId>> mRetryQueue;
Dlocal_connection.cpp133 FrameId id(cookie, frame->transmitter()); in transferFrame()
183 mPendingFrames.erase(FrameId(info.cookie(), info.transmitter())); in ackFrame()
213 FrameId id = mRetryQueue.top().second; in onTimeout()
367 FrameId id = idIt->second; in onError()